Hattie Ann Hammock

Hattie Ann Hammock
Friday, June 30th, 2023 ~ Friday, June 30th, 2023

Hattie Ann Hammock was born at 5:28am on June 30, 2023 in Oklahoma City to Claye and Kolby (Caraway) Hammock. Hattie lived for over an hour surrounded by the love of her mom and dad before being fully healed in the arms of Jesus.

She is survived by her parents; grandparents, Eddy Jr and Cindy Caraway, Troy and Julie Hammock; aunts and uncles, Coltin and Chelsea Caraway, Cole and Mackenna Hammock, Cash Hammock; cousin, Orrin Caraway; and her great grandparents and other family. She is preceded in death by her maternal and paternal great grandfathers.

In her short life, Hattie taught her parents to seek joy in all things, even in the midst of sorrow. Her parents cherish the time spent with Hattie Ann and would do it all over again for one more minute.
